Galois representations ramified at one prime and with suitably large image

Published 18 Oct 2022 in math.NT | (2210.10152v2)

Abstract: Let $p\geq 7$ be a prime and $n>1$ be a natural number. We show that there exist infinitely many Galois representations $\varrho:Gal(\bar{\mathbb{Q}}/\mathbb{Q})\rightarrow GL_{n}(\mathbb{Z}_p)$ which are unramified outside ${p, \infty}$ with large image. More precisely, the Galois representations constructed have image containing the kernel of the mod-$pt$ reduction map $SL_n(\mathbb{Z}_p)\rightarrow SL_n(\mathbb{Z}/pt\mathbb{Z})$, where $t:=8(n2-n)\left(3+\lfloor log_p(2n+1)\rfloor\right)+8$. The results are proven via a purely Galois theoretic lifting construction. When $p\equiv 1\mod{4}$, our results are conditional since in this case, we assume a very weak version of Vandiver's conjecture.
